Hecate did kill that big ugly behind her on the beach. It is a Mirelurk Queen. A new critter in F4. It took a couple of grenades and half a magazine from her sniper rifle. But like the old saying goes: The bigger they are, the easier they are to hit.

I don't know if there is a rebreather yet or not in F4. But there is an Aquaboy/girl perk you can take. It not only gives you waterbreathing, but also makes you immune from swimming based radiation. Hecate took it so she could look around under the waves.

Winter Wolf: The sub (The Yangtze) was doing more than recon. It was a ballistic sub, and it fired all of its strategic missiles at the start of the war, as it was ordered to. It might be the source of the nukes you see in the tutorial of the game. The Yangtze quest is a good one. It gives you the option of helping the captain or killing him. Helping him has it benefits, but for Hecate it was just the right thing to do.

The ghoul in the trenchcoat is one of the first characters you meet in Fallout 4. He is the Vault Tec salesman who appears in the tutorial, and sells you your place in Vault 111. He tried getting into the Vault when the bombs fell, but they wouldn't let him in. So he had to survive the old-fashioned way, by becoming a ghoul! You can talk him into coming back to Sanctuary Hills (where you lived before the war, and start the game).

The jet pack has been a lot of fun. It does not let you actually fly. More like make extended jumps. But it has allowed Elektra to jump (mostly) clear of a mine she stepped on. It is also great for leaping across radioactive rivers by making timed bursts of jet. Likewise it allows her to jump off really high buildings and cushion her fall with short bursts of jet. A few times she has even leaped across fatal drops to get at baddies across the gaps between roofs or scaffolds.

Lopov: The entire GOAT exam makes an appearance in F4. This time it is a test to detect androids, like the one from Bladerunner. But the questions are all exactly the same.

Raiders do wear Power Armor in F4. There is no special training required. Just the suit and a fusion core to power it. It does take skills to soup it up though.
